Event Overview

The Providence Wind Turbine Tour is set for June 4, 2025, from 10:00 AM to 11:00 AM at the Narragansett Bay Commission in Providence, RI. This event is organized by the Green Energy Consumers Alliance in collaboration with John Motta, an engineer from the Narragansett Bay Commission. Participants will have the chance to learn about the wind turbine that contributes to the Community Choice Electricity program, which serves several towns including Barrington, Central Falls, and Newport.
